I've only entered the UK a twice for business but on neither occasion was asked to provide documentation.

One of those visits was for a nine-week in house training program and I had been provided with a letter to present if necessary but it was not requested.

EDIT: Just read your link properly and noticed it was specifically about those entering with a visa. I didn't - if you do then your documentation standards will probably be higher.
 
I'm not entering on a visa. Just have a document from the UK head office saying I have to come over to provide training & support to our staff over there.

Was just a bit worried after hearing horror stories of people being turned away on arrival.
 
Been there a few times for work and pleasure and never been asked about what work but have had some aggressive immigration people quiz me about how did I meet the person I was staying with etc etc but nothing that a few polite answers didn't fix.
